Job Description: Reporting to: Finance Director/ Group FC and Divisional Director (strong dotted line)
Main purpose of role:
To prepare, co-ordinate and control the production of accurate and timely financial information for all sites within the Division
To ensure that site profit & loss account, balance sheet, procedures and controls comply with Group policies and acceptable accounting principles
To assist the Divisional Director in the interpretation of financial information to ensure achievement of operating targets
To actively promote and implement the compliant adoption of Group financial initiatives
To proactively assist the Divisional Director and Finance Director in identifying and implementing cost reduction initiatives and commercial enhancements
To review, take responsibility for and line manage territory accountant(s)Main tasks:
To produce accurate and timely monthly accounts for each site, which will require the candidate to do this themselves for a number of sites as well as managing a territory accountant(s) to do the same for further sites
Manage the activity of the territory accountant(s) in the Division and to ensure the finance staff deliver agreed targets and objectives
Ensure all financial information is produced accurately and on-time
Prepare the monthly accounts, budgets, forecasts and year-end packs
Ensure site financial controls are effectively implemented and monitored
Prepare such other financial reports as may from time to time be required
To assist the Divisional Director in the interpretation of financial information in order to maximise the financial performance of the Division
Prepare and present financial information to the Divisional management team
To liaise closely with the Finance Director/ Group FC, keeping him fully informed of current and potential future issues which may affect the financial performance of the Division and the Company
Undertake such ad hoc projects and tasks as the Finance Director/ Group FC may require
Ensure compliance with all Group accounting procedures and policies
Manage the day-to-day performance of the Territory/ Management Accountant(s) and to ensure the resourcing of all Accountant positions in the Division with suitably qualified staff
To ensure adequate succession planning is implemented throughout the Divisional accounting team so that staff shortages do not impact adversely the achievement of agreed targets
To undertake such other tasks as may, from time to time, be reasonably required
Key competencies:
Attention to detail – in a high volume low value site it is essential that detailed transactions are accounted for and reported accurately
Honesty, integrity, open style
Factual and driven by the desire/ need to improve the accuracy and efficiency of accounting, reporting and control
Leadership skills – able to lead the Divisional finance team in the interpretation and implementation of financial, operational and strategic objectives
Delegation – able to delegate authority to appropriately skilled team members and to monitor effectively delegated tasks
Staff development – able to develop the skills of the Territory Accountant(s) through close liaison with HR
Commercial awareness – credible, supportive and pro-active business partner to the Divisional Director
Communication skills – highly developed written and oral communication skills and the ability to communicate effectively to audiences of all sizes
Data rational – able to compile, interpret and present data
Time management – able to deliver business critical reports accurately and on-time
Change management – must demonstrate the ability to readily accept and implement change
Qualifications/ experience:
A formal accountancy qualification (ACA/ CIMA/ACCA)
Must have at least 5 years relevant experience in a similar position.
Multi site experience preferably in a high volume/ low value branch network environment
Highly developed Microsoft Excel skills
